What can I see and do near Lost Acres Vineyard?
You might spend a leisurely day outdoors at Enders State Forest and McLean Game Refuge. Explore nature at Limon Pond and Arnold Pond. Tunxis State Forest, Grace Kellogg Preserve and Hartland Recreation Area are worth a stop while you're in the area.
